First Impressions – Lightweight, Smart, and Built for Convenience
The KVV Electric Golf Push Cart with Remote Control is designed for golfers who want to enjoy walking the course without the strain of pushing or carrying their bag.
Its compact fold, lightweight frame, and remote-control functionality make it a practical option for everyday golfers looking for convenience and value.
Key Features
Remote Control OperationControl the cart with ease using the handheld remote. Move forward, reverse, left, and right without pushing.
Compact & Lightweight DesignFolds down quickly for easy storage and transport. Ideal for smaller vehicles or limited storage space.
Long-Lasting BatteryReliable lithium battery designed to last through a full 18-hole round.
Downhill Speed ControlMaintains consistent speed on slopes to prevent the cart from accelerating uncontrollably.
Stable and Durable BuildWide wheelbase and solid construction provide balance and performance on typical course terrain.
What Golfers Like
Reduces physical strain during rounds
Easy to operate once familiar with the remote
Compact design fits easily in most trunks
Strong value compared to higher-priced electric carts
Things to Consider
Remote control has a short learning curve
Build quality is solid but not premium-tier
Performance may vary on very steep terrain
Who This Cart Is Best For
Golfers who prefer walking but want less effort
Players upgrading from a manual push cart
Those looking for an affordable electric option
Golfers needing a compact, easy-to-store cart
Final Verdict
The KVV Electric Golf Push Cart with Remote Control delivers a strong balance of performance, portability, and affordability.
For golfers who want to walk the course while conserving energy, this is a reliable entry-level electric option that gets the job done.
